California·Code INS Insurance Code - INS·Div. 5. DIVISION 5. INSURANCE ADJUSTERS·Ch. 1. CHAPTER 1. Insurance Adjuster Act·Art. 3. ARTICLE 3. Regulation, Licensing, and Registration
Any badge or cap insignia worn by a person who is a licensee, officer, director, partner, manager, or employee of a licensee shall be of a design approved by the commissioner, and shall bear on its face a distinctive word indicating the name of the licensee and an employee number by which such person may be identified by the licensee.

Legislative History

Added by Stats. 1980, Ch. 1190, Sec. 11. Operative July 1, 1981, by Sec. 13 of Ch. 1190.
